Introducing "Making Friends Is an Art! Essential Reading for Kids", a captivating children’s book by renowned author Julia Cook. This inspiring tale takes young readers on a journey with a captivating brown colored pencil who finds himself feeling alone and misunderstood. As he interacts with his colorful friends, he learns crucial lessons about friendship, self-worth, and the beautiful diversity that makes friendship meaningful. What age group is this book suitable for?

This book is aimed at children aged 6-8 years old, making it perfect for early elementary school readers.

What are the main themes of the book?

The story revolves around friendship, self-acceptance, and the importance of recognizing individual strengths and qualities.

Can this book be used for educational purposes?

Absolutely! It serves as a great resource for parents and educators to encourage discussions about friendship and social skills.

What types of illustrations are included?

The book features vibrant and engaging illustrations that captivate children's attention and complement the narrative.

Is there a message about diversity in the story?

Yes! The brown colored pencil symbolizes diversity and the positive impact of embracing differences among friends.
